  • Page 8: Getting Started

    Your Razer Basilisk V3 can store up to 5 profiles from the Razer Synapse app, allowing you to use these profiles even on systems without the app installed. Pressing the profile button will cycle through the different profiles, with the profile indicator’s color showing which profile is currently selected.

  • Page 14 Hypershift mode is a secondary set of button assignments that is activated when the Hypershift key is held down. By default, the Hypershift key is assigned to the fn key of your Razer Synapse supported keyboard however, you can also assign any mouse button as a Hypershift key.
  • Page 15 Upon selecting a button assignment, you may then change it to one of the following functions: Default This option enables you to return the mouse button to its original setting. Keyboard Function This option changes the button assignment into a keyboard function. You can also choose to enable Turbo mode which allows you to emulate a repeated keyboard function while the button is held down.
  • Page 16 Sensitivity This function allows you to manipulate the DPI setting of your Razer Basilisk V3 with a touch of a button. Listed below are the Sensitivity options and their description: ▪...
  • Page 17 Switch Lighting allows you to easily switch between all advanced lighting effects. This function will only be visible when the Chroma Studio module is installed. Razer Hypershift Setting the button to Razer Hypershift will allow you to activate Hypershift mode as long as the button is held down. Launch Program Launch Program enables you to open an app or a website using the assigned button.
